<p>Rest In Peace Wepa Man 🙏🕊️<br><br>90’s Latin House Mix 4 is a tribute to the Vargas sound—Danny Vargas and Victor Vargas—aka The Vargas Brothers. This set leans into that classic NYC Latin house era where swing-heavy drums, piano stabs, and Afro-Caribbean percussion meet Spanglish chants and barrio pride.<br><br>Expect "Wepa" energy, call-and-response vocals, and those signature Juzt 2 Brothers arrangements that made their records a staple for Latin dance floors in the 90s. If you grew up on this sound (or you’re studying the roots), this one’s for you.<br><br>Featuring / Spotlight:<br>Danny “Holiday” Vargas (Wepa Man) + Victor Vargas (The Vargas Brothers)<br><br>Tracklist:<br>01.
